The Sorting Place

If you have books to donate for the book sale, The Sorting Place is where they go. We appreciate your donations as this is an integral part of our fund raising.

Location: 1010 West 10th Street.

Open Wednesdays from approximately 10AM to 2PM.

Drop off book donations at The Sorting Place or the library.

An Evening with Michael Johnson

| Print | PDF 
Micheal Johnson in convert in Loveland
Michael Johnson re-scheduled
Thursday, March 11, 2010 
7:30 p.m.
The Rialto Theater, Downtown Loveland
Tickets: $18
Tickets are available at The Rialto Box Office or on-line at CityofLoveland.org/rialto.
  • Included in the evening are fine wines and a gourmet chocolate buffet
  • A Fine Art Silent Auction featuring works by artists such as George Walbye, Clyde Aspevig & Charles Cross will add to our fun evening

Join us in hosting an evening in the sweet distillation of the solo voice and classical guitar artistry of recording star Michael Johnson. His work has won him a Grammy nomination and #1 Hits in the Country, Pop and R& B categories. His life’s path has included music training in Barcelona and Brazil with guitar masters Tarrago and Bonfa. He has toured Broadway with Jacques Brel is Alive and Well and Living in Paris, performed with John Denver, and has released 20 albums during his career. Michael Johnson is the scheduled special guest at the 12th Annual John Denver Tribute Concert in Aspen.


 

 

News Release
Friends of the Loveland Public Library Foundation
300 North Adams, Loveland, Colorado
970-962-2712   www.friendsofthelovelandlibrary.org

    The Friends of the Loveland Public Library is sponsoring “An Evening with Michael Johnson” on Thursday, March 11, 2010 at the Rialto Theater in downtown Loveland.  Proceeds from the concert along with a wine and chocolate buffet and a silent auction of fine art will benefit the Library’s Renovation/Expansion Project.  Tickets are $18 per person and are available at the Rialto Theater or at www.ci.loveland.co.us/rialto.

    Solo voice and classical guitar artist Michael Johnson is known for songs including “Bluer than Blue,” “Give me Wings,” “That’s That” and “This Night will Last Forever.” His classical guitar mastery is evident in all his work but especially in Villa-Lobos’ “Study in E Minor.”

    His work has won a Grammy nomination and #1 hits in the country, pop and R&B categories. His life’s path as taken him from birth in Alamosa and schooling in Denver to college at CSU and music training in Barcelona and Brazil with the guitar masters Tarrago and Bonfa. Johnson toured with the Broadway production of Jacques Brel is Alive and Well and Living in Paris, joined with John Denver to complete the Chad Mitchell Trio and has released 20 albums during the past three decades.
